Why are my pop up sprinkler heads not coming out?
The pop-up sprinkler heads have a smooth gliding stem that allows the nozzle to rise when water supply is turned on. If it is not coming out to the proper height, it may be clogged with debris deposits.

What happens when a sprinkler head is activated?
When a sprinkler head is activated, the clapper opens allowing water to flow through the valve to feed the system. As the alarm port becomes exposed to water pressure, it causes a water motor gong, mechanical bell, or A/V device to sound.

How do sprinklers reduce the risk of dying in a fire?
When sprinklers are present, the risk of dying in a home fire decreases by nearly 80%. Sprinklers reduce the average property loss by 71%. Sprinkler systems are designed to control a fire for a sufficient time to enable people to escape. Ten minutes is considered an adequate amount of time.
How does a straight pipe sprinkler system work?
The straight pipe riser, or vertical supply pipe within the fire sprinkler system, does not have a retard chamber or alarm port like other types of wet pipe fire sprinkler systems. Instead, this sys- tem has a riser check valve. A riser check valve utilizes a vane type waterflow detector to monitor water – flow in the fire sprinkler system.
